SOUTH CHINA SEA. INDONESIA. DNC 04, DNC 11. DISTRESS SIGNAL RECEIVED FROM M/V AVOCET IN 00-06.6N 105-37.0E AT 091119Z JUN. VESSELS IN VICINITY REQUESTED TO KEEP A SHARP LOOKOUT, ASSIST IF POSSIBLE. REPORTS TO MRCC SINGAPORE, TELEX: 20021, PHONE: 656 226 5539, FAX: 656 227 9971, E-MAIL: POCC@MPA.GOV.SG.
